A valuable resource for couples and singles who are looking to adopt combines the author's own expertise with personal advice from adoptive parents, covering a vast array of issues and questions surrounding the adoption process, international adoption, costs, and much more. Original.

Richard Mintzer is a prolific author with twenty-four nonfiction books to his credit, and bylines in American Baby and Parent-Age. For nine years, he was co-editor of Adoptalk. He has spoken on adoption at seminars and hosted New York City's only weekly adoption-related radio program. He lives in New York City with his wife Carol and their two children.
